[dpdk-dev,v2] net/ixgbe: remove tpid check for fdir filter
Checks
Commit Message
DPDK community has several emails discussion on this topic,
these mails link is bellow:
http://dpdk.org/ml/archives/dev/2017-March/060379.html,
http://dpdk.org/ml/archives/dev/2017-March/060295.html,
items like VLAN can already have several valid "types"
(0x88a8, 0x8100, 0x9100), and who knows what will come up
in the future.And ixgbe_flow just ignores the types when do
filter configuration. So it may be reasonable to delete the
related tpid check process.
Also add some more comment log on stack explanation.
v2:
-add dpdk community mail link for this topic.
Fixes: 11777435c72 ("net/ixgbe: parse flow director filter")
Signed-off-by: Wei Zhao <wei.zhao1@intel.com>
